Official title

A Resolution By The Board Of County Commissioners Of Pasco County, Florida, Congratulating Nine Athletes And The Coaching Staff From The Hudson High School Cheerleading Team For Winning At The ICU World Championship

ANRAS, the U.S. National Junior Coed Team, competed from April 25th to the 26th, 2024, against other junior co-ed national teams from around the world in the ICU World Championship at the ESPN Worldwide World of Sports Complex in Orlando. ANRAS, the U.S. National

    Junior Coed team, won first place at the ICU World Championship. Championship in their division with Team Finland winning second place and Team Norway winning third place. And RASI athletes on the U.S. National Junior Coed team completed the hardest junior co-ed routine in the history of the junior co-ed division, meaning that the skill level was an all-time high. And Raz, the athletes from Hudson High School were able to meet people and make friends with athletes from all over the world. And

    Res cheerleading now has an Olympic bid, meaning it can be picked by future Olympic uh by future games to become an official Olympic sport.
